On top of all that, this more limited iMovie has steep horsepower requirements that rule out most computers older than about two years old. None of your transitions, titles, credits, music, or special effects are preserved. All you can import is the clips themselves. Incredibly, the new iMovie can't even convert older iMovie projects. And you can't have more than one project open at a time. You can no longer export only part of a movie.Īll visual effects are gone-even basic options like slow motion, reverse motion, fast motion, and black-and-white. You can't add chapter markers for use in iDVD, which is supposed to be integrated with iMovie. For years, I've relied on 's iMovie plug-ins to achieve effects like picture-in-picture, bluescreen and subtitles. The new iMovie doesn't accept plug-ins, either. No pitch changing, high-pass and low-pass filters, or reverb. The program creates a fade-out at the end of an audio clip, but you can't control its length or curve.Īll the old audio effects are gone, too. You can't manually adjust audio levels during a scene (for example, to make the You can choose one piece of music to put behind the video, but that's it. The new iMovie gets a D for audio editing. You have no indication of how many minutes into your movie you are.
